Output 21f2cdb0a45eab5169b4e7346d487545586bd20fc74ff97c56532bf60f6a2729:1

value
1634302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0edc83505c2bd7043e3f43f35fc6e66b973214e OP_EQUAL
address
3PevwyDrzbVvuQBJnN7bSWHzNYUDBTZdHN
transaction
21f2cdb0a45eab5169b4e7346d487545586bd20fc74ff97c56532bf60f6a2729